Tom Parker Bowles reckoned the playful and broadly European menu at Jackson Boxer’s new restaurant “reads like a well-crafted thriller. It grabs you by the gut and makes the heart pump harder.”
The highlights of his meal included a half chicken that was “all charred skin and buxom flesh, the juices shot through with an elegant acidic swathe”, and a plate of crab-fat rice with brown crab meat that was “a joyous, sun-baked Balearic blast of pure crustacean bosk”.
“Boxer was always a talented chef,” Tom concluded. “He’s now proved himself, once and for all, as a very serious restaurateur.”
